Description
Shackleton Advisers has agreed to acquire Aberdein Considine Wealth, adding approximately £800m in assets under management. This acquisition will increase Shackleton's total assets in Scotland to over £1.3bn. The deal enhances Shackleton's presence with offices in Aberdeen, Glasgow, and Edinburgh, while also providing AC Wealth clients access to enhanced resources and investment capabilities.

What does Aberdein Considine Wealth do?
Aberdein Considine Wealth, previously part of Aberdein Considine, is a financial advice firm that serves clients with a dedicated team of advisers. With a workforce of 40, it provides a range of wealth management services. It is privately held, operating in Financial Services, and is based in Scotland.
